  2. The people are not so much for the old cures as they were before. When the doctors were scarce the people depended a lot upon the old cures, but they are mostly done away with now. Many people visit holy wells always. On the 15th of August a good many people of this district go to St. Factna's well near Rosscarbery and make ''rounds'' there. There is a ''surefeit'' well near Bandon and when an animal would have a surfeit people go there for a bottle of water. A few cures are.
    Headache:- A cup of strong tea.
    Chilblains:- Meat pickle.
    Pheumonia:- Bran poultice.
    Corns:- Castor oil.
